About

Dexcelbot was registered and founded in Shenzhen in November 2024 by Yang Sicheng (among the earliest core members of Tencent's Robotics X lab) and Li Wangwei (former head of tactile perception systems at Tencent Robotics X, PhD from the National University of Singapore), focusing on the R&D and manufacturing of core robot components: high-performance dexterous hands, tactile sensors, and dexterous manipulation algorithms. The flagship Apex Hand five-finger dexterous hand was released in August 2025 - ultra-dexterous, highly dynamic, high-payload, and fully sensing, able to turn screws and sew clothes, hailed by the industry as a 'hexagonal warrior'. Its technical route is all-round balance pragmatism, focusing on six dimensions: dexterity, response speed, payload capacity, robustness, tactile sensing, and control precision, and it stands at the world's top level in tendon and hybrid actuation (as assessed by Primavera Capital and Nanshan Strategic Emerging Investment). It completed 5 rounds of funding within a year (hundreds of millions RMB cumulatively), backed by Shenzhen Capital Group, Fortune Capital, and Primavera Capital with Shenzhen state capital participating; first product deliveries began in H1 2026, entering volume delivery of dexterous hands.

Technical Approach

An 'all-round balance' pragmatist route: refuses blind pursuit of extremes in any single metric, focusing on the six dimensions of dexterity, response speed, payload capacity, robustness, tactile sensing, and control precision. The view that tactile perception is core to embodied AI data infrastructure - only when the dexterous hand can truly sense objects do the collected tactile and force-control data have training value. Its tendon-hybrid transmission is at the world's top level, aiming to build high-DoF dexterous hands with performance-reliability-cost as the core advantage.

Commercialization(4)

  • First product deliveries began in H1 2026 (revealed by founder Yang Sicheng; source: Chuangyebang/Sina Finance, Apr 2026)
  • Dexterous hand products have entered the production and delivery stage, repositioned from research equipment to reliable productivity tools
  • 2026 is seen by the industry as the 'delivery year' for dexterous hands; the company targets a scenario-data-cost closed loop
  • Provides core component support for smart manufacturing, medical applications, service robots, and other fields

Position & Strengths(5)

  • Top-tier team background: Tencent Robotics X core members with 10+ years of accumulated expertise and dual academic-industrial DNA
  • Dual-drive strategy: dexterous hands plus tactile sensors, mastering core components and data infrastructure capability
  • Full-stack R&D capability: among the very few in China with 0-to-1 full-stack in-house development of dexterous hand + tactile sensors + dexterous manipulation algorithms
  • Rapid fundraising capability: 5 rounds in a year, with top institutions continuously adding and Shenzhen state capital backing
  • Accelerating volume delivery: speeding up Apex Hand capacity expansion and batch delivery after the Pre-A
